can you tell a product color from the serial number/ model number
If i give information from my Setting>general>about page could people use information from there (seria, modle number or otherwise) to determine my ipad color?

Yes - a model (order) number can be used to reveal the colour and other specifications of an iPad.
The “A” number identifies only the generic model - however, the Model Order number (e.g., MPME2B/A) reveals a lot more information about the device - such as the intended market (country/region), its colour and its internal storage. Armed with Apple’s Model Order Number, a Google search is often all that is required to discover the specific details.
Both model numbers are exposed in recent versions of iOS/iPadOS:
Settings > General > About - tap on the model number field to switch between the Model Number and the Model Order Number.
